VictoriaLogs MCP Server The implementation of Model Context Protocol (MCP) server for VictoriaLogs. This provides access to your VictoriaLogs instance and seamless integration with VictoriaLogs APIs and documentation. It can give you a comprehensive interface for logs, observability, and debugging
